i first heard them when i was 10 back in 2000. i loved yellow and trouble but the radio never named the band that played those songs.

fast forward to when AROBTTH was released

 

and i heard clocks...

i was with my family going somewhere and i was in the back seat (where fortunately i was closer to the speakers)

anyways i got goosebumps and chills. that has NEVER happened to me for ANY song ive ever heard, even to this day.

i remember thinking "this is the most beautiful song i have ever heard in my life"

and i as i looked out the back seat window, i was fully enjoying this amazing song.

 

but it would take the video for the scientist to let me know (finally) that the band i was loving was called Coldplay. i wrote down the name of the band on the palm of my hand I immidiately went to buy AROBTTH before the ink washed off. =)

 

my cousin later told me that they were also the band who played yellow and trouble

and THAT mystery was solved too.

 

i guess i have always loved them , even though i did not know it at first. =)

I had been waiting around in science class, waiting for the bell to ring when I looked over and saw this girl with a Viva La Vida Tour shirt on. I guess the idea stuck in my head because next time I was searching for new music I ended up typing Coldplay. Now, it's not that I hated Coldplay I had just been into an entirely different genre. Basically it wasn't my thing. My bf listened to them and I put up with it but I never truely listened to it. I had "Violet Hill" and "Fix You" but that was about it. Well, that one fateful day I bought "Lovers In Japan" and I instantly fell in love. I felt energized, and a song hadn't done that to me in a very long time. Not even a month later, my uncle died. No one close to me had died before, so I wasn't sure how to feel. So I bottled up whatever I was feeling and drowned it out with music. I needed new music to listen to; the stuff I had always listened to just made me feel annoyed at the situation and didn't help me feel better. I remembered how much I liked "Lovers In japan" and decided to give Coldplay a shot. I bought the while Viva La Vida album and put it onto my iPod. Driving to the wake (it was 45 minutes away) I listened to the album. I was blown away. I began listening to it over and over again. I quickly bought more and more. Chris' voice completely mesmerized me. I had even begun liking "Viva La Vida" which I didn't really like before. It began a whole new music obsession and I wouldn't have it any other way. Coldplay has helped me get through a very tough year, and I can honestly say they've changed my life. Though it's only been 8 months, I still feel that I can say that I am a true Coldplay fan. I went to All Points West and stood in ankle deep mud for eight hours just to see them. I would never do that for any other band. But Coldplay isn't just any band, they're the best band ever :D
